Hello everyone. Just completed my open water cert with my wife and daughter along with other members of our Scout Troop. We did our OW dives at Breakwater in Monterey. I'll probably be doing beginner level dives in the Monterey area as well as Catalina and other So-Cal locations with a yearly trip to Hawaii/Mexico/Caribbean.

I'll also be looking for dive opportunities for the Troop.
 
Welcome to scubaboard and to the diving hobby. There's lots of great diving in California and Catalina in the peak of summer will feel borderline tropical after diving Monterey in the Spring/early summer. I would especially recommend spending a weekend in Avalon and diving Casino Point.
